Skip to content

Commit 2808569

Browse files
Merge pull request #7026 from ggouaillardet/topic/openpmix_refresh
pmix/pmix4x: refresh to the latest open PMIx master
2 parents f4371f7 + 1c4a359 commit 2808569

File tree

723 files changed

+9286
-1258
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

723 files changed

+9286
-1258
lines changed

.gitignore

Lines changed: 45 additions & 45 deletions
Original file line numberDiff line numberDiff line change
@@ -373,51 +373,51 @@ opal/mca/hwloc/base/static-components.h.new.struct
373373

374374
opal/mca/installdirs/config/install_dirs.h
375375

376-
!opal/mca/pmix/pmix*/pmix/AUTHORS
377-
!opal/mca/pmix/pmix*/pmix/contrib/perf_tools/Makefile
378-
opal/mca/pmix/pmix*/pmix/include/pmix/autogen/config.h
379-
opal/mca/pmix/pmix*/pmix/include/pmix/autogen/config.h.in
380-
opal/mca/pmix/pmix*/pmix/src/include/private/autogen/config.h.in
381-
opal/mca/pmix/pmix*/pmix/src/include/private/autogen/config.h
382-
opal/mca/pmix/pmix*/pmix/src/include/frameworks.h
383-
opal/mca/pmix/pmix*/pmix/src/mca/pinstalldirs/config/pinstall_dirs.h
384-
opal/mca/pmix/pmix*/pmix/config/autogen_found_items.m4
385-
opal/mca/pmix/pmix*/pmix/config/mca_library_paths.txt
386-
opal/mca/pmix/pmix*/pmix/config/test-driver
387-
opal/mca/pmix/pmix*/pmix/src/include/pmix_config.h
388-
opal/mca/pmix/pmix*/pmix/src/include/pmix_config.h.in
389-
opal/mca/pmix/pmix*/pmix/include/pmix_common.h
390-
opal/mca/pmix/pmix*/pmix/include/pmix_rename.h
391-
opal/mca/pmix/pmix*/pmix/include/pmix_version.h
392-
opal/mca/pmix/pmix*/pmix/src/util/keyval/keyval_lex.c
393-
opal/mca/pmix/pmix*/pmix/src/util/show_help_lex.c
394-
opal/mca/pmix/pmix*/pmix/examples/alloc
395-
opal/mca/pmix/pmix*/pmix/examples/client
396-
opal/mca/pmix/pmix*/pmix/examples/debugger
397-
opal/mca/pmix/pmix*/pmix/examples/debuggerd
398-
opal/mca/pmix/pmix*/pmix/examples/dmodex
399-
opal/mca/pmix/pmix*/pmix/examples/dynamic
400-
opal/mca/pmix/pmix*/pmix/examples/fault
401-
opal/mca/pmix/pmix*/pmix/examples/jctrl
402-
opal/mca/pmix/pmix*/pmix/examples/pub
403-
opal/mca/pmix/pmix*/pmix/examples/server
404-
opal/mca/pmix/pmix*/pmix/examples/tool
405-
opal/mca/pmix/pmix*/pmix/test/run_tests00.pl
406-
opal/mca/pmix/pmix*/pmix/test/run_tests01.pl
407-
opal/mca/pmix/pmix*/pmix/test/run_tests02.pl
408-
opal/mca/pmix/pmix*/pmix/test/run_tests03.pl
409-
opal/mca/pmix/pmix*/pmix/test/run_tests04.pl
410-
opal/mca/pmix/pmix*/pmix/test/run_tests05.pl
411-
opal/mca/pmix/pmix*/pmix/test/run_tests06.pl
412-
opal/mca/pmix/pmix*/pmix/test/run_tests07.pl
413-
opal/mca/pmix/pmix*/pmix/test/run_tests08.pl
414-
opal/mca/pmix/pmix*/pmix/test/run_tests09.pl
415-
opal/mca/pmix/pmix*/pmix/test/run_tests10.pl
416-
opal/mca/pmix/pmix*/pmix/test/run_tests11.pl
417-
opal/mca/pmix/pmix*/pmix/test/run_tests12.pl
418-
opal/mca/pmix/pmix*/pmix/test/run_tests13.pl
419-
opal/mca/pmix/pmix*/pmix/test/run_tests14.pl
420-
opal/mca/pmix/pmix*/pmix/test/run_tests15.pl
376+
!opal/mca/pmix/pmix*/openpmix/AUTHORS
377+
!opal/mca/pmix/pmix*/openpmix/contrib/perf_tools/Makefile
378+
opal/mca/pmix/pmix*/openpmix/include/pmix/autogen/config.h
379+
opal/mca/pmix/pmix*/openpmix/include/pmix/autogen/config.h.in
380+
opal/mca/pmix/pmix*/openpmix/src/include/private/autogen/config.h.in
381+
opal/mca/pmix/pmix*/openpmix/src/include/private/autogen/config.h
382+
opal/mca/pmix/pmix*/openpmix/src/include/frameworks.h
383+
opal/mca/pmix/pmix*/openpmix/src/mca/pinstalldirs/config/pinstall_dirs.h
384+
opal/mca/pmix/pmix*/openpmix/config/autogen_found_items.m4
385+
opal/mca/pmix/pmix*/openpmix/config/mca_library_paths.txt
386+
opal/mca/pmix/pmix*/openpmix/config/test-driver
387+
opal/mca/pmix/pmix*/openpmix/src/include/pmix_config.h
388+
opal/mca/pmix/pmix*/openpmix/src/include/pmix_config.h.in
389+
opal/mca/pmix/pmix*/openpmix/include/pmix_common.h
390+
opal/mca/pmix/pmix*/openpmix/include/pmix_rename.h
391+
opal/mca/pmix/pmix*/openpmix/include/pmix_version.h
392+
opal/mca/pmix/pmix*/openpmix/src/util/keyval/keyval_lex.c
393+
opal/mca/pmix/pmix*/openpmix/src/util/show_help_lex.c
394+
opal/mca/pmix/pmix*/openpmix/examples/alloc
395+
opal/mca/pmix/pmix*/openpmix/examples/client
396+
opal/mca/pmix/pmix*/openpmix/examples/debugger
397+
opal/mca/pmix/pmix*/openpmix/examples/debuggerd
398+
opal/mca/pmix/pmix*/openpmix/examples/dmodex
399+
opal/mca/pmix/pmix*/openpmix/examples/dynamic
400+
opal/mca/pmix/pmix*/openpmix/examples/fault
401+
opal/mca/pmix/pmix*/openpmix/examples/jctrl
402+
opal/mca/pmix/pmix*/openpmix/examples/pub
403+
opal/mca/pmix/pmix*/openpmix/examples/server
404+
opal/mca/pmix/pmix*/openpmix/examples/tool
405+
opal/mca/pmix/pmix*/openpmix/test/run_tests00.pl
406+
opal/mca/pmix/pmix*/openpmix/test/run_tests01.pl
407+
opal/mca/pmix/pmix*/openpmix/test/run_tests02.pl
408+
opal/mca/pmix/pmix*/openpmix/test/run_tests03.pl
409+
opal/mca/pmix/pmix*/openpmix/test/run_tests04.pl
410+
opal/mca/pmix/pmix*/openpmix/test/run_tests05.pl
411+
opal/mca/pmix/pmix*/openpmix/test/run_tests06.pl
412+
opal/mca/pmix/pmix*/openpmix/test/run_tests07.pl
413+
opal/mca/pmix/pmix*/openpmix/test/run_tests08.pl
414+
opal/mca/pmix/pmix*/openpmix/test/run_tests09.pl
415+
opal/mca/pmix/pmix*/openpmix/test/run_tests10.pl
416+
opal/mca/pmix/pmix*/openpmix/test/run_tests11.pl
417+
opal/mca/pmix/pmix*/openpmix/test/run_tests12.pl
418+
opal/mca/pmix/pmix*/openpmix/test/run_tests13.pl
419+
opal/mca/pmix/pmix*/openpmix/test/run_tests14.pl
420+
opal/mca/pmix/pmix*/openpmix/test/run_tests15.pl
421421

422422

423423
opal/mca/pmix/ext4x/ext4x.c

opal/mca/pmix/pmix4x/Makefile.am

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,7 @@ EXTRA_DIST = autogen.subdirs
1515

1616
dist_opaldata_DATA = help-pmix-pmix4x.txt
1717

18-
SUBDIRS = pmix
18+
SUBDIRS = openpmix
1919

2020
sources = \
2121
pmix4x.h \
@@ -43,7 +43,7 @@ mcacomponent_LTLIBRARIES = $(component_install)
4343
mca_pmix_pmix4x_la_SOURCES = $(sources)
4444
mca_pmix_pmix4x_la_CFLAGS = $(opal_pmix_pmix4x_CFLAGS)
4545
mca_pmix_pmix4x_la_CPPFLAGS = \
46-
-I$(srcdir)/pmix/include $(opal_pmix_pmix4x_CPPFLAGS)
46+
-I$(srcdir)/openpmix/include $(opal_pmix_pmix4x_CPPFLAGS)
4747
mca_pmix_pmix4x_la_LDFLAGS = -module -avoid-version $(opal_pmix_pmix4x_LDFLAGS)
4848
mca_pmix_pmix4x_la_LIBADD = $(top_builddir)/opal/lib@[email protected] \
4949
$(opal_pmix_pmix4x_LIBS)

opal/mca/pmix/pmix4x/autogen.subdirs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
pmix
1+
openpmix

opal/mca/pmix/pmix4x/configure.m4

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-59,7 +59,7 @@ AC_DEFUN([MCA_opal_pmix_pmix4x_CONFIG],[
5959
[opal_pmix_pmix4x_args="--with-devel-headers $opal_pmix_pmix4x_args"])
6060
CPPFLAGS="-I$OPAL_TOP_SRCDIR -I$OPAL_TOP_BUILDDIR -I$OPAL_TOP_SRCDIR/opal/include -I$OPAL_TOP_BUILDDIR/opal/include $CPPFLAGS"
6161

62-
OPAL_CONFIG_SUBDIR([$opal_pmix_pmix4x_basedir/pmix],
62+
OPAL_CONFIG_SUBDIR([$opal_pmix_pmix4x_basedir/openpmix],
6363
[$opal_pmix_pmix4x_args $opal_subdir_args 'CFLAGS=$CFLAGS' 'CPPFLAGS=$CPPFLAGS'],
6464
[opal_pmix_pmix4x_happy=1], [opal_pmix_pmix4x_happy=0])
6565

@@ -83,9 +83,9 @@ AC_DEFUN([MCA_opal_pmix_pmix4x_CONFIG],[
8383
AC_MSG_ERROR([CANNOT CONTINUE])])
8484
# Build flags for our Makefile.am
8585
opal_pmix_pmix4x_LDFLAGS=
86-
opal_pmix_pmix4x_LIBS="$OPAL_TOP_BUILDDIR/$opal_pmix_pmix4x_basedir/pmix/src/libpmix.la"
87-
opal_pmix_pmix4x_CPPFLAGS="-I$OPAL_TOP_BUILDDIR/$opal_pmix_pmix4x_basedir/pmix/include -I$OPAL_TOP_BUILDDIR/$opal_pmix_pmix4x_basedir/pmix -I$OPAL_TOP_SRCDIR/$opal_pmix_pmix4x_basedir/pmix/include -I$OPAL_TOP_SRCDIR/$opal_pmix_pmix4x_basedir/pmix"
88-
opal_pmix_pmix4x_DEPENDENCIES="$OPAL_TOP_BUILDDIR/$opal_pmix_pmix4x_basedir/pmix/src/libpmix.la"])
86+
opal_pmix_pmix4x_LIBS="$OPAL_TOP_BUILDDIR/$opal_pmix_pmix4x_basedir/openpmix/src/libpmix.la"
87+
opal_pmix_pmix4x_CPPFLAGS="-I$OPAL_TOP_BUILDDIR/$opal_pmix_pmix4x_basedir/openpmix/include -I$OPAL_TOP_BUILDDIR/$opal_pmix_pmix4x_basedir/openpmix -I$OPAL_TOP_SRCDIR/$opal_pmix_pmix4x_basedir/openpmix/include -I$OPAL_TOP_SRCDIR/$opal_pmix_pmix4x_basedir/openpmix"
88+
opal_pmix_pmix4x_DEPENDENCIES="$OPAL_TOP_BUILDDIR/$opal_pmix_pmix4x_basedir/openpmix/src/libpmix.la"])
8989

9090
AC_SUBST([opal_pmix_pmix4x_LIBS])
9191
AC_SUBST([opal_pmix_pmix4x_CPPFLAGS])
@@ -94,7 +94,7 @@ AC_DEFUN([MCA_opal_pmix_pmix4x_CONFIG],[
9494

9595
# Finally, add some flags to the wrapper compiler so that our
9696
# headers can be found.
97-
pmix_pmix4x_status_filename="$OPAL_TOP_BUILDDIR/$opal_pmix_pmix4x_basedir/pmix/config.status"
97+
pmix_pmix4x_status_filename="$OPAL_TOP_BUILDDIR/$opal_pmix_pmix4x_basedir/openpmix/config.status"
9898
pmix_pmix4x_WRAPPER_EXTRA_CPPFLAGS=`egrep PMIX_EMBEDDED_CPPFLAGS $pmix_pmix4x_status_filename | cut -d\" -f4`
9999
pmix_pmix4x_WRAPPER_EXTRA_LDFLAGS=`egrep PMIX_EMBEDDED_LDFLAGS $pmix_pmix4x_status_filename | cut -d\" -f4`
100100
pmix_pmix4x_WRAPPER_EXTRA_LIBS=`egrep PMIX_EMBEDDED_LIBS $pmix_pmix4x_status_filename | cut -d\" -f4`

opal/mca/pmix/pmix4x/pmix/Makefile.am renamed to opal/mca/pmix/pmix4x/openpmix/Makefile.am

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-11,7 +11,7 @@
1111
# All rights reserved.
1212
# Copyright (c) 2006-2016 Cisco Systems, Inc. All rights reserved.
1313
# Copyright (c) 2012-2013 Los Alamos National Security, Inc. All rights reserved.
14-
# Copyright (c) 2013-2018 Intel, Inc. All rights reserved.
14+
# Copyright (c) 2013-2019 Intel, Inc. All rights reserved.
1515
# Copyright (c) 2019 Amazon.com, Inc. or its affiliates. All Rights
1616
# reserved.
1717
# $COPYRIGHT$
@@ -32,7 +32,7 @@ AM_DISTCHECK_CONFIGURE_FLAGS = --disable-dlopen
3232
headers =
3333
sources =
3434
nodist_headers =
35-
EXTRA_DIST = AUTHORS README HACKING INSTALL VERSION LICENSE autogen.pl
35+
EXTRA_DIST = AUTHORS README HACKING INSTALL VERSION LICENSE autogen.pl Makefile.pmix-rules
3636

3737
# Only install the valgrind suppressions file and man pages
3838
# if we're building in standalone mode
Lines changed: 37 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,37 @@
1+
# -*- makefile -*-
2+
# Copyright (c) 2008-2018 Cisco Systems, Inc. All rights reserved.
3+
# Copyright (c) 2008 Sun Microsystems, Inc. All rights reserved.
4+
# Copyright (c) 2019 Intel, Inc. All rights reserved.
5+
# $COPYRIGHT$
6+
#
7+
# Additional copyrights may follow
8+
#
9+
# $HEADER$
10+
#
11+
12+
TRIM_OPTIONS=
13+
14+
.1in.1:
15+
$(PMIX_V_GEN) $(top_srcdir)/contrib/make_manpage.pl \
16+
--package-name='@PACKAGE_NAME@' \
17+
--package-version='@PACKAGE_VERSION@' \
18+
--pmix-date='@PMIX_RELEASE_DATE@' \
19+
--input=$< \
20+
--output=$@
21+
22+
.3in.3:
23+
$(PMIX_V_GEN) $(top_srcdir)/contrib/make_manpage.pl \
24+
--package-name='@PACKAGE_NAME@' \
25+
--package-version='@PACKAGE_VERSION@' \
26+
--pmix-date='@PMIX_RELEASE_DATE@' \
27+
$(TRIM_OPTIONS) \
28+
--input=$< \
29+
--output=$@
30+
31+
.7in.7:
32+
$(PMIX_V_GEN) $(top_srcdir)/contrib/make_manpage.pl \
33+
--package-name='@PACKAGE_NAME@' \
34+
--package-version='@PACKAGE_VERSION@' \
35+
--pmix-date='@PMIX_RELEASE_DATE@' \
36+
--input=$< \
37+
--output=$@

0 commit comments

Comments
 (0)